Company / Location Information

A.O. Smith is a global leader applying innovative technologies and energy-efficient solutions to products manufactured and marketed worldwide. The company is one of the world’s leading manufacturers of residential and commercial water heating equipment and boilers, as well as a manufacturer of water treatment products for residential and light commercial applications. A. O. Smith is headquartered in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, with approximately 12,000 employees at operations in the United States, Canada, China, India, Mexico, the Netherlands, and the United Kingdom.

Primary Function

We’re seeking a driven and strategic Continuous Improvement (CI) Manager to lead transformational initiatives across our manufacturing facility. You will champion a culture of operational excellence and drive efficiency, productivity, and quality through Lean and data-driven improvement methods. If you thrive on solving complex problems, empowering teams, and delivering measurable impact—this role is for you.

Scope of Responsibility

  • Annual budgetary responsibility
  • May supervise a team of up to 3 indirect reports and/or direct reports
  • Complexity: High. Requires the successful execution of business plans by leading through influence instead of direct authority. Requires high level of emotional intelligence in addition to quickly assimilating information from multiple sources along complex operational and administrative processes. Must be able to clearly articulate complex ideas to teach and guide others.
  • Travel: 5-10%. International travel may be required.
  • Other: Cross-functional responsibility for ensuring improvement is undertaken with an A. O. Smith Operating System approach, considering the process integration, people systems, and technical issues that may be impacted.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and execute CI strategies that align with plant and company-level KPIs (Safety, Quality, Delivery, Cost, HRD).
  • Facilitate kaizen events, root cause analysis (RCA), and cross-functional workshops to solve operational challenges.
  • Coach and mentor employees at all levels to embed Lean thinking and continuous improvement tools (5S, SMED, A3).
  • Partner with production, engineering, quality, and supply chain teams to identify, prioritize, and implement CI projects and multiyear savings plans / CIP (Cost Improvement Plans).
  • Use data analysis and visual management tools (dashboards, value stream maps, process maps) to uncover opportunities and track improvements.
  • Develop training materials and lead CI capability-building programs across the facility.
  • Promote a hands-on, floor-focused presence to drive daily engagement and sustainment of improvements.
  • Support digital transformation initiatives (e.g., real-time data collection, MES, Industry 4.0) where applicable.
